java wrote:

> One of my players posed an interesting question to me on Saturday after
> our game. He said to me "Scott, what is the difference between a ball type
> spell and the cloud spell in the Grimthingy?" Being the knowledgeable GM
> that I was I said, "well um...er, well one is a ball and the other is a
> cloud!!! Yea that's it. Anyone have a reasonable answer for me?

The only difference (or at least - only stated difference) is the damage
code; Foocloud spells have a damage code of Medium, Fooball starts at
Serious. Otherwise, both have the same area of effect and so on.
